E-Skin is Redefining Tech-Human Relations

Electronic skin (e-skin) is a flexible, stretchable, and often self-healing material embedded with sensors that mimic the properties and functions of human or animal skin. It is designed to sense environmental stimuli such as pressure, temperature, strain, humidity, and even chemicals – just like natural skin does. These materials usually combine nanotechnology, polymers, and flexible circuits.

Technologies used:

  1. Nanomaterials: Carbon nanotubes, graphene, nanowires.
  2. Polymers: PDMS (Polydimethylsiloxane), polyurethane.
  3. Conductive inks: For printing flexible circuits.
  4. Piezoelectric and triboelectric materials: For energy harvesting or pressure sensing.
